    We're looking for Critical Care Junior Doctors to join our Intensive care medicine team at The Harborne Hospital, our brand-new, purpose built, state-of-the-art £100m facility opened January, We are hosting a variety of outpatient and inpatient services across 50 beds, including 6 level 3 critical care beds, with predominant specialities including Cardiology/Cardiac Surgery, Cancer and Complex Surgery.

    As a Resident Doctor you'll cover our level 3 Critical Care Adult Unit, and general wards, acting on Consultant-Led decisions in partnership with highly specialist Nurses.

    Day-to-day this could include pre-op or post-op treatments, clinical assessments, ward rounds or clerking admissions, reviewing discharges, assessing referrals and providing immediate medical care such as attending and leading on emergency cardiac arrest calls or other instances where patients need your medical specialist support.

    While we are a Consultant Led Service, we believe in empowering our Resident Doctors, so your role could become expand as much as you wish.

    You'll have the chance to be involved in audits, projects and quality improvement initiatives alongside the opportunity to join a variety of internal networks.

    This could be to help steer the services you deliver, speaking up or patient satisfaction focus groups, clinical governance or MDT meetings.

    Giving you an opportunity to network with your peers, share best practice and expand your knowledge in an unrivalled setting.
